Локальная разработка сайта: 5 преимуществ, которые помогут вам сэкономить время и деньги

Создание сайта – ответственный и трудоемкий процесс, который требует не только знаний, но и времени. Однако, существует отличное решение, как ускорить разработку и снизить затраты времени и денег – локальная разработка сайта. В этой статье мы расскажем о пяти преимуществах использования локального окружения для создания сайта.

1. Независимость от интернета

Одним из главных преимуществ локальной разработки является независимость от интернета. Вы можете работать над сайтом даже без доступа в Интернет и не беспокоиться о его скорости и качестве соединения.

2. Ускорение процесса разработки

Работая в локальном окружении, вы можете быстро запускать и протестировать изменения на локальном сервере без необходимости постоянных загрузок данных на удаленный сервер. Это позволяет существенно сократить время, затрачиваемое на разработку сайта.

3. Удобство работы с различными платформами

Локальная разработка позволяет легко переключаться между различными платформами, такими как Windows, macOS или Linux. Это делает процесс разработки более удобным и эффективным, особенно если вы используете различные инструменты разработки.

4. Более безопасное тестирование

Создание сайта на локальном сервере предоставляет более безопасное окружение для тестирования и отладки, чем веб-хостинг, поскольку вы можете создать резервную копию своего проекта, прежде чем загружать его на сервер.

5. Сокращение расходов

В конечном итоге, использование локальной разработки сайта может помочь вам значительно сократить расходы, связанные с разработкой и испытаниями, т.к. вы можете использовать бесплатные или недорогие инструменты и не платить за хостинг на начальных этапах.

Что такое локальная разработка сайта

Определение

Локальная разработка сайта — это процесс создания и тестирования веб-ресурса на компьютере разработчика, без необходимости подключения к интернету.

Принцип работы

Для локальной разработки сайта можно использовать специальное программное обеспечение, например, XAMPP или MAMP, которое позволяет создать локальный сервер на компьютере.

После установки и настройки программы, можно создать все необходимые файлы и папки, создать базу данных и тестировать работу сайта.

Преимущества

  • Экономия времени и денег: локальная разработка позволяет избежать расходов на хостинг и оптимизировать процесс разработки.
  • Удобство: разработчик может работать над проектом в любое время, не завися от интернет-соединения.
  • Контроль: локальная разработка позволяет контролировать процесс создания сайта, изменять и тестировать его без необходимости публикации.
  • Безопасность: при локальной разработке сайта данные находятся только на компьютере разработчика и не подвергаются риску хакерской атаки.

Преимущество 1: Сокращение времени разработки

Универсальность использования

Локальная разработка сайта позволяет программистам обеспечить универсальность использования кода на разных устройствах и платформах. Они могут работать на нескольких проектах одновременно, пересекать код нескольких проектов и использовать одни и те же библиотеки и фреймворки, что позволяет эффективно использовать ресурсы компьютера и максимально сократить время разработки.

Отсутствие задержек

Когда сайт разрабатывается на удаленном сервере, возможны задержки, связанные с проблемами с интернет-соединением, работой хостинга и дополнительных сложностей, которые могут влиять на процесс разработки. Локальная разработка сайта позволяет программистам работать в условиях, когда не налагаются никакие ограничения и зависимости от внешних факторов, что значительно сокращает время их работы и увеличивает эффективность проекта.

Ускорение процесса тестирования

После завершения разработки сайта необходимо проводить тестирование функционала и проверять его на разных устройствах и платформах. Если сайт был разработан на локальном компьютере, то выполнение тестирования занимает гораздо меньше времени, поскольку большинство проблем были решены до этого этапа.

  • Использование локальной разработки сайта минимизирует ошибки и приводит к более быстрому и точному процессу разработки.
  • Программисты могут работать самостоятельно и проверять работу своих программ и кода без ограничений со стороны хостинга.
  • Ускорение процесса тестирования и упрощение его проведения – вот основные преимущества использования локальной разработки сайта.

Преимущество 2: Экономия денег на хостинге и серверном оборудовании

Отсутствие ежемесячной платы за хостинг

Одним из главных преимуществ локальной разработки сайта является отсутствие необходимости оплачивать услуги хостинг-провайдера каждый месяц. При локальной разработке сайта вы можете использовать свои собственные компьютеры и не нуждаться в аренде серверного пространства. Это позволяет существенно сэкономить деньги.

Экономия на серверном оборудовании

Еще одним преимуществом локальной разработки сайта является экономия на серверном оборудовании. Вместо того, чтобы покупать дорогостоящее серверное оборудование, вы можете использовать свои собственные компьютеры для создания сайта и тестирования его работоспособности.

Более высокая безопасность сайта

Когда вы работаете с локальным сервером, ваш сайт находится на более надежной платформе, чем в случае использования общедоступных серверов в интернете. Это уменьшает риск взлома сайта и утечки данных пользователей, что может привести к затратам на восстановление сайта и жалобам на компанию владельца сайта.

Повышенная скорость работы сайта

При использовании локального сервера, скорость загрузки страниц и производительность вашего сайта будут выше, чем при использовании общедоступных серверов в интернете. Это делает ваш сайт более быстрым и отзывчивым для пользователей, что может привести к увеличению конверсии.

Преимущество 3: Независимость от интернет-соединения

Продуктивная работа в любых условиях

Интернет-соединение не всегда надежно и стабильно. При отсутствии доступа в сеть возможны задержки и сбои в работе себя и ваших коллег. Работая на локальном сервере, вы избавляетесь от проблем с интернет-соединением и можете продолжать свою работу даже при отключении от сети.

Конфиденциальность и безопасность данных

При работе в интернете возможна утечка или хищение данных. Локальная разработка сайта позволяет сохранять все данные локально, в безопасности. Никакие данные не отправляются в сеть, что делает работу на локальном сервере более безопасной.

  • Никакая информация не находится в интернете, что защищает данные от кражи;
  • Если вы работаете с конфиденциальными данными своих клиентов, работа локально позволяет их обезопасить, не становясь предметом угроз извне;
  • Ваш разработчик владеет полным контролем над инфраструктурой и данными.

Преимущество 4: Использование локальных сервисов и API

1. Быстрый доступ к локальным сервисам

Локальные сервисы, такие как базы данных, веб-серверы и кеширование, доступны непосредственно с вашего компьютера, что делает доступ к ним намного более быстрым, чем при обращении к удаленным сервисам. Это позволяет сократить время ожидания ответа и ускорить процесс разработки.

2. Использование локальных API

Некоторые приложения зависят от внешних API, чтобы получать доступ к информации или функциональности. Использование локальных API позволяет вам максимально использовать возможности приложения, без задержек, связанных с обменом данными с удаленными серверами. Это особенно важно для приложений, которые работают с большим объемом данных или требуют высокой скорости работы.

3. Уверенность в безопасности данных

При работе с удаленными сервисами и API, ваша информация может быть скомпрометирована или доступна третьим лицам. Использование локальных сервисов и API обеспечивает бóльший контроль над безопасностью ваших данных, что важно для приложений, которые содержат конфиденциальную информацию.

4. Экономия времени и денег

Использование локальных сервисов и API позволяет сократить время ожидания ответа и ускорить процесс разработки. Кроме того, использование локальных сервисов и API позволяет сократить затраты на облачные ресурсы и услуги.

Преимущество 5: Удобство тестирования и отладки

Как работает?

Локальная разработка сайта позволяет удобно тестировать и отлаживать код до того, как он будет загружен на удаленный сервер. Вы можете легко проверить, как ваш сайт будет выглядеть и работать в разных браузерах и на разных устройствах.

При желании можно запустить локальный сервер и тестировать динамические функции и базы данных, без опасения повредить живой сайт. Будучи в локальной среде, вы можете даже имитировать поведение пользователей и проверить, как ваш сайт будет реагировать на разные действия.

Как сэкономить время и деньги?

Выбрав локальную разработку вместо разработки на удаленном сервере, вы экономите время, которое потратили бы на отправку файлов на сервер, ожидание загрузки и обновления страницы. Вы сможете изменять код быстро и легко, не переживая за скорость соединения.

Благодаря возможности отлаживать код локально, вы можете быстрее и точнее исправлять ошибки и устранять неполадки, которые могли бы запутать вас на удаленном сервере. Кроме того, вы экономите деньги на оплате хостинга, так как не нужно покупать отдельный аккаунт для разработки и тестирования.

  • Удобное тестирование и отладка кода
  • Возможность проверки сайта в разных браузерах и на разных устройствах
  • Отсутствие необходимости отправлять файлы на удаленный сервер
  • Более быстрая и точная отладка кода
  • Экономия времени и денег

Как начать локальную разработку сайта

Шаг 1: Выберите платформу

Первым шагом для начала локальной разработки сайта является выбор подходящей платформы. Существует несколько платформ, таких как Windows, Mac и Linux, которые имеют свои собственные инструменты для разработки сайтов.

Шаг 2: Установите локальный сервер

Чтобы иметь возможность запустить и тестировать сайт локально, вам понадобится установить локальный сервер. Существует множество локальных серверов, таких как Apache, Nginx и IIS. Они бесплатны и доступны для всех платформ.

Шаг 3: Создайте рабочую папку

Как только у вас есть локальный сервер, вы можете создать рабочую папку, где будут храниться файлы проекта. Эта папка должна иметь доступ к локальному серверу, чтобы вы могли взаимодействовать с вашим сайтом локально.

Шаг 4: Начните разработку

Теперь, когда вы настроили всё необходимое, вы готовы приступить к разработке вашего сайта локально. Создавайте файлы HTML, CSS и JavaScript, чтобы увидеть, как ваш сайт будет выглядеть и функционировать.

  • Большое преимущество локальной разработки заключается в том, что вы можете работать над проектом без доступа к интернету;
  • Также вы можете легко исправлять ошибки и тестировать функциональность вашего сайта без риска нанести ущерб вашему общедоступному сайту;

Вопрос-ответ:

В каком формате нужно хранить файлы проекта при локальной разработке сайта?

Обычно файлы проекта хранятся в папке в корне диска (например, C:\\mysite) или в папке на рабочем столе. В зависимости от используемого веб-сервера, необходимо настроить путь к файлам через его настройки. Также полезно использовать систему контроля версий, такую как Git, для управления версиями и историей изменений.

Могу ли я использовать локальный сервер для тестирования сайта на разных операционных системах?

Да. Локальный сервер может использоваться для тестирования сайта на разных операционных системах, но необходимо убедиться, что на каждой системе установлены все необходимые компоненты и настройки сервера.

Что делать, если возникнут проблемы или ошибки при локальной разработке сайта?

В случае проблем или ошибок при локальной разработке сайта, полезно начать с проверки настроек сервера и файлов проекта. Также может помочь проверка журналов ошибок. Если проблема не решается, можно обратиться к онлайн сообществам разработчиков или технической поддержке хостинга или серверного оборудования.

Какие веб-серверы можно использовать для локальной разработки сайта?

Существует множество веб-серверов, которые могут быть использованы для локальной разработки сайта, например, Apache, Nginx, IIS и другие. Некоторые из них являются бесплатными, а другие требуют покупки лицензии. Каждый из них имеет свои особенности и настройки, которые могут быть полезны в зависимости от конкретного проекта.

Могу ли я использовать локальный сервер для разработки и тестирования базы данных?

Да, локальный сервер может быть использован для разработки и тестирования базы данных. Для этого необходимо установить соответствующую систему управления базами данных, такую как MySQL, PostgreSQL или MS SQL Server, и настроить ее для работы с локальным сервером.

Как избежать проблем при переносе локально разработанного сайта на боевой сервер?

Для избежания проблем при переносе локально разработанного сайта на боевой сервер следует проверить, что все настройки веб-сервера, базы данных и файлов проекта соответствуют требованиям сервера. Также полезно использовать систему контроля версий для отслеживания изменений и внесения необходимых исправлений до отправки на сервер.

Как выбрать веб-сервер для локальной разработки сайта?

Выбор веб-сервера для локальной разработки сайта зависит от проводимого проекта и используемых технологий. Некоторые веб-серверы предпочтительнее для определенных языков программирования, фреймворков или приложений. Поэтому сначала следует определиться с технологиями проекта, а затем найти подходящий веб-сервер для работы.

Могу ли я использовать локальный сервер для тестирования сайта на мобильных устройствах?

Да, локальный сервер может быть использован для тестирования сайта на мобильных устройствах, но для этого необходимо настроить Wi-Fi-сеть и сделать доступным локальный сервер для подключения мобильных устройств. Также необходимо убедиться, что сайт корректно отображается на мобильных устройствах.

Можно ли использовать локальный сервер для разработки и тестирования RESTful API?

Да, локальный сервер может быть использован для разработки и тестирования RESTful API. Для этого необходимо настроить сервер для работы с RESTful API и использовать соответствующие инструменты и библиотеки для создания, тестирования и документирования API.

Какой инструмент рекомендуется использовать для локальной разработки сайта?

Выбор инструмента для локальной разработки сайта зависит от ваших личных предпочтений и требований проекта. Некоторые из наиболее популярных инструментов для локальной разработки сайта включают в себя XAMPP, WAMP, MAMP и другие. Однако, все зависит от технологического стека проекта и желаемых функциональных возможностей.

Как проверить работоспособность сайта локально без использования интернета?

Локально проверить работоспособность сайта можно с помощью локального веб-сервера. Для тестирования сайта необходимо запустить локальный сервер и открыть сайт в браузере по адресу http://localhost/. Если сайт корректно отображается и функционирует, то можно считать его работоспособность проверенной.

Какое преимущество локальной разработки сайта для тех, кто не является профессиональным программистом?

Локальная разработка сайта может быть полезна для людей, которые не являются профессиональными программистами, потому что она позволяет быстро и легко создавать и тестировать свой сайт без необходимости оплачивать услуги профессиональных разработчиков. Это может быть полезно для создания личных сайтов, блогов, онлайн-магазинов и других веб-приложений.

Как связана локальная разработка сайта с операционной системой?

Локальная разработка сайта тесно связана с операционной системой, на которой работает компьютер разработчика. Веб-серверы и другие програмные средства для локальной разработки могут быть оптимизированы и настроены для работы под определенную операционную систему. Также операционная система может определять доступные для использования инструменты и настройки функций веб-сервера.

Отзывы

Елена Васильева

Очень интересная и практичная статья! Я всегда думала, что локальная разработка сайта – это профессиональное занятие, требующее определенных знаний и навыков. Однако, благодаря этой статье, я поняла, что и самостоятельно можно создать сайт с помощью локальной разработки, и сэкономить время и деньги. Ясно и доступно описаны все преимущества локальной разработки, в том числе возможность работать без доступа в Интернет и удобный контроль версий. Кажется, что я обязательно попробую создать свой локальный сайт и сэкономлю не только время, но и деньги! Спасибо за практичную статью.

Ольга

Мне очень понравилась статья про локальную разработку сайта! Я полностью согласна с автором, ведь разработка сайта на локальной машине действительно позволяет экономить время и деньги. Ведь так можно избежать затрат на хостинг и доменное имя во время создания и тестирования сайта. Также, работая локально, можно быстро и беспрепятственно менять код и тестировать его без проблем. Преимущества налицо! А еще, например, когда я создавала свой первый сайт, я использовала локальный сервер, и это очень помогло мне понять, как устроен процесс создания и поддержки сайта. В целом, я бы порекомендовала локальную разработку сайта всем, кто хочет создать сайт или обновить уже существующий, но не хочет тратить слишком много времени и денег. Отличная статья, спасибо!

Екатерина

Очень полезная статья! Я часто занимаюсь созданием своих сайтов и раньше не задумывалась о локальной разработке. Но после прочтения этой статьи я стала понимать, что это действительно очень удобно и экономит много времени и денег. К тому же, можно экспериментировать с дизайном и функционалом сайта, не боясь повредить настоящий сайт. Большое спасибо за советы и объяснения! Я обязательно попробую использовать локальную разработку для своих будущих проектов.

Мария

Очень интересная статья о разработке сайтов! Всегда думала, что для создания сайта нужно пользоваться удаленными серверами, так как не знала о локальной разработке. Очень удобно, что можно сохранять все изменения на своем компьютере и не беспокоиться о сторонних сбоях или потере данных. Буду точно использовать этот метод в разработке своего сайта. Дополнительно решила прочитать про IDE, так как раньше пользовалась только стандартными средами разработки, а посмотрев на преимущества IDE, понимаю, что это намного удобнее и быстрее. Спасибо за полезную информацию!

Анна

Я очень благодарна за эту статью, ведь она очень полезная и интересная для меня как для человека, который интересуется созданием сайтов. В статье было много интересных моментов, особенно про локальную разработку. Я, как начинающий разработчик, пока работаю над сайтом в онлайн-редакторе, потому что думала, что локальную разработку надо ставить только на профессиональном уровне. Статья показала, что это не таксложно, а даже просто и удобно. Локальная разработка позволяет работать быстрее и без задержек при загрузке страниц, что очень важно, когда ищешь нужный файл или код. Кроме того, это выполняет все задачи на компьютере и не связано с подключением к интернету, что позволяет сильно сократить затраты времени на работу. В статье также было отмечено, что локальная разработка позволяет быстро тестировать сайт на различных устройствах, что, безусловно, помогает избежать многих ошибок. Статья дала мне уверенность в том, что я могу осуществить локальную разработку самостоятельно и я сэкономлю не только время, но и деньги на этом. Благодарю вас за этот материал, я обязательно воспользуюсь этими советами.

KateGreen

Полностью согласна с автором статьи о преимуществах локальной разработки сайта. Это огромное преимущество, так как позволяет сэкономить время и деньги на работе с сайтом. К тому же, существует возможность тестирования и модификации сайтов в локальной среде без доступа к Интернету. Большим плюсом также является отсутствие необходимости определенной скорости интернета для работы с сайтом, что экономит время и повышает эффективность работы. И самое важное – облегчается процесс разработки веб-сайта и его последующего освоения, поскольку вы можете работать над сайтом и вносить изменения в него, не находясь на сервере. В целом, локальная разработка сайта — это не только удобное, но и функциональное решение для тех, кто сталкивается с построением и обслуживанием веб-сайтов. Я настоятельно рекомендую всем знакомиться с этой темой и продолжать совершенствовать свои навыки для более эффективной работы в сфере веб-дизайна и разработки.

VK
Pinterest
Telegram
WhatsApp
OK
Прокрутить вверх